"Don Juan, Op. 20" is a thrilling tone poem that vividly depicts the legendary seducer's adventures, filled with passion, drama, and a sense of relentless pursuit. It's a work that showcases Strauss's early compositional prowess and his ability to create a compelling musical story.
"Ein Heldenleben, Op. 40" is a sprawling, ambitious work that Strauss subtitled "A Hero's Life." This six-movement orchestral piece is a semi-autobiographical exploration of the composer's own life and career, filled with triumph, conflict, and introspection. Each movement paints a different scene, from the hero's battles with his detractors to his peaceful reflections in his "Wallstatt" (wall garden).
